The Charm of Brick Arch Garden Gates
In the world of garden design, few features can evoke a sense of timeless elegance and rustic charm quite like a brick arch garden gate. These gates serve not only as entrances to our lush outdoor spaces but also as stunning focal points that can elevate the aesthetics of any garden. Made from durable materials and designed with an artistic flair, brick arch garden gates can blend seamlessly with both traditional and modern landscapes.
The use of brick in construction dates back centuries, showcasing its enduring appeal. Bricks offer a variety of colors and textures, allowing for immense creativity in the design process. From the warm tones of red and orange to the cooler shades of gray, a brick arch gate can be tailored to complement the surrounding garden plants and pathways. Additionally, the rustic feel of brick adds a touch of authenticity to gardens, particularly those inspired by English country gardens or Mediterranean villas.
One of the most captivating aspects of a brick arch garden gate is its structural design. The arch itself not only serves a practical purpose by providing a sturdy entry point but also creates a sense of grandeur. Arches have long been symbolic in architecture, representing strength and stability. In a garden setting, they invite visitors to enter and explore the beauty that lies beyond. This makes a brick arch gate a perfect transitional element, seamlessly guiding the eye from the outside world into the serene surroundings of a garden.

Moreover, a brick arch garden gate can be embellished with various materials to enhance its beauty. Climbing plants, such as roses or wisteria, can be encouraged to vine around the arch, creating a romantic and enchanting entryway that changes with the seasons. In spring, blossoms can frame the arch, while in autumn, vibrant leaves can provide a stunning backdrop. This living element not only adds interest but also integrates nature into the design, making the gate a thriving part of the garden ecosystem.
A brick arch garden gate also conveys a sense of privacy and security, distinguishing your personal sanctuary from the outside world. It adds a layer of intimacy, making a garden feel more secluded and cherished. For gardeners who enjoy hosting gatherings or quiet reflections, this element becomes essential in creating a peaceful retreat.
In terms of maintenance, brick is a wonderfully resilient material. Unlike wooden gates that may warp or require regular repainting, brick arches are relatively low-maintenance. An occasional wash and inspection for weeds around the base can keep the gate looking pristine. This durability allows the gate to withstand the test of time, both in terms of aesthetics and structural integrity.
